About NAMI Texas

NAMI Texas is a leading statewide nonprofit organization dedicated to improving the lives of Texans affected by mental illness. As the Texas affiliate of the National Alliance on Mental Illness, NAMI Texas advances education, advocacy, support, and public awareness to build better lives for individuals and families impacted by mental health conditions. With a strong public profile, deep policy engagement, and a network of local affiliates across the state, NAMI Texas plays a critical role in shaping Texas’s mental health landscape.


Position Overview

NAMI Texas seeks a dynamic, visionary, and mission-driven Executive Director to lead the organization during a pivotal period of growth and influence. This is a high-profile leadership role requiring a strategic thinker, skilled communicator, and collaborative executive with demonstrated success in nonprofit leadership, public policy, and stakeholder engagement.

The Executive Director serves as the chief executive officer of the organization and is responsible for setting strategic direction, leading statewide advocacy efforts, strengthening organizational capacity, and serving as the primary public spokesperson for NAMI Texas.


Key Responsibilities


Strategic Leadership & Governance


  • Partner with the Board of Directors to set and execute a long-term strategic vision aligned with NAMI Texas’s mission and values
  • Provide transparent reporting and guidance to the Board on organizational performance, risks, and opportunities
  • Lead organizational planning, evaluation, and continuous improvement initiatives


Public Policy & Advocacy


  • Serve as the lead advocate and voice for NAMI Texas in the Texas Legislature, state agencies, and public forums
  • Build and maintain strong relationships with policymakers, government leaders, and advocacy coalitions
  • Advance policy priorities that improve mental health systems, access to care, and equity across Texas


External Relations & Public Presence


  • Act as the primary spokesperson for NAMI Texas with media, donors, partners, and the public
  • Strengthen the organization’s brand, visibility, and reputation statewide
  • Cultivate strategic partnerships with foundations, corporations, healthcare systems, and community organizations


Organizational & Financial Management


  • Oversee day-to-day operations, staff leadership, and organizational culture
  • Ensure strong financial stewardship, including budgeting, fundraising, and compliance
  • Lead and support a high-performing senior leadership team committed to equity, inclusion, and excellence


Fund Development


  • Drive diversified revenue strategies including individual giving, grants, sponsorships, and major gifts
  • Engage donors and funders as partners in advancing NAMI Texas’s mission


Qualifications & Experience


  • Minimum of 10 years of senior leadership experience in a nonprofit, advocacy, healthcare, or public policy organization
  • Proven success leading complex organizations with multiple stakeholders
  • Strong understanding of mental health systems, public policy, or social impact advocacy (Texas experience strongly preferred)
  • Exceptional communication and relationship-building skills
  • Demonstrated commitment to diversity, equity, inclusion, and lived-experience-informed leadership
  • Experience working with or reporting to a governing board


Preferred Attributes


  • Recognized leader with credibility in public policy, nonprofit, or mental health spaces
  • Experience serving as a public spokesperson or media representative
  • Ability to navigate political, legislative, and community environments with diplomacy and integrity
